Transaction 34cc5c55aabfa18e071f99dc046a4e5ef67e0985364a1c655bd1763e0a31231d
1 Input
1 Output
-
34cc5c55aabfa18e071f99dc046a4e5ef67e0985364a1c655bd1763e0a31231d:0
- value
- 1427990
- script pubkey
- OP_0 OP_PUSHBYTES_20 d66ab7410fd0f55aa5c9699f4b350a1701c1c740
- address
- bc1q6e4twsg06r644fwfdx05kdg2zuqur36qhmhyjk